Abstract: For cellular mobile telecommunication, cell identification is an indispensable initial process to establish a communication link. Cell identification requires high computational complexity and accuracy in a short time, especially during the handover process. To achieve high-performance cell identification with low-complexity for the orthogonal frequency division multiplexing (OFDM) systems, this work proposes an efficient cell ID search technique. Simulation results show that the proposed cell ID search method has better performance and lower computational complexity than conventional methods, in multipath Rayleigh fading channels.
